Henri Cartier-Bresson’s inventive work in the early 1930s opened up creative possibilities in the world of photography forever. Although Bresson is best known for street photography, he was also known for his patience. The important technique of the “decisive moment”, transmitted by the photographer, makes us think that most of his photographs were taken with a single click, at the precise moment of the occasion, however, Bresson took a moment to make more than 20 images in a single scene.

The more photos you see, the better you’ll see as a photographer
Photographs in the rain in the middle of the forest, urban exploration and night photographs show that photographing can often be a lonely experience, but take the time to study the work of other photographers, present and past. it can be a great way to motivate yourself and emerge in photographic ideas.
Studying the work of colleagues and analyzing the techniques used by them can improve their work and facilitate their experimentation process.
Another tip: If you often photograph colorful and vibrant elements, try to focus your studies on black and white and minimalist photographs, plus asking for advice and sharing your ideas can also be a great way to build relationships with other photographers.
